Jewish virtual library, viewed 04 September 2015 : KATZ, MENKE (KATZ, MENKE (1906–1991), Yiddish and English poet. Known as Menke (Méyn-keh) in Yiddish literature, he was born in Svintsyan (now Švenčionys, Lithuania) and spent World War I in Micháleshik (Michalishki, Belarus) before immigrating to New York in 1920)
